Inscribedattached period card reads: "Taken by D.C. Collins, Phil. And in the Franklin Institute and as I was there one Evening I heard some people looking at it say 'half past nine and fast asleep.' F.A. Mitchell." Back of card has label: "A.G. Elliot & Co. / *Paper* / Philadelphia, Pa / Represented by / A. G. Elliot, Jr."
On View
Not on viewCollections
DescriptionImage of woman covered with blanket wearing a covering over her head, asleep in a rocking chair. Piece has hand coloring on shawl.Full leather push button case-plain; purple velvet plain liner; early mat
